Wrexham to Saltney (partial) redoubling

Post by dwrathan »

A new facing turnout has been laid in the (LMS) Down Main at Saltney Junction (towards the GWR Up) ready for the redoubling. No sign of any other work from Saltney towards Wrexham. Jeff.

Work has now started between Rossett and Balderton . The formation of the former Down line has been cleared for much of the way and some new ballast has arrived. Jeff.
